Dave Timko

Biography

Click to downloadDave Timko, an Emmy-award winning television journalist with more than two decades of experience, is a senior editor, producer and director for CNN Productions. In those roles, Timko has helped produce over 30 documentaries for CNN Presents and CNN: Special Investigations Unit. He is based in CNN’s world headquarters in Atlanta.

Timko joined CNN in 1985 as a video journalist and has held various production and editing roles as he carved out a niche as documentary filmmaker, regularly shooting, producing and editing long-form programs for the network. He joined CNN Productions, the network division that handles long-form programming and specials, at its inception in 2001. Since then, he’s had senior roles in documentaries including God’s Warriors, Black in America, Grady’s Anatomy, America Remembers and Homicide in Hollenbeck.

Among his awards is a National Emmy for Hurricane Katrina: Heroes of the Storm in 2006, and the Alfred I. duPont-Columbia Silver Baton for God’s Warriors
in 2008.

Timko graduated from Kent State University with a bachelor’s degree in communications.
